Side-by-side financial comparison of UTAH MEDICAL PRODUCTS INC (UTMD) and Village Farms International, Inc. (VFF).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Village Farms International,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($12.2M vs $9.0M, roughly 1.4× UTAH MEDICAL PRODUCTS INC). UTAH MEDICAL PRODUCTS INC runs the higher net margin — 28.4% vs 19.9%, a 8.5%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Village Farms International,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(31.5% vs -1.2%).
